Output 81e3484897f818dcfb9beb817e6843eb8a690d4a4e5c1c906da544477a002f38:0

value
509600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33156cb0b1b52935c0c8aa14dfb17a1cefb92161 OP_EQUAL
address
36M83w2s44yoJeEnSs4TaD7CyewhFMPnnC
transaction
81e3484897f818dcfb9beb817e6843eb8a690d4a4e5c1c906da544477a002f38
confirmations
314093
spent
true